Renesas Electronics Unveils Industry-Leading Fully Encapsulated Dual 30A and Single 33A Digital Power Modules |  Düsseldorf – Renesas Electronics today announced two new fully encapsulated digital DC/DC PMBus® power modules that deliver the highest power density and efficiency in their class. The dual ISL8274M operates from a 5V or 12V power rail, provides two 30A outputs and up to 95.5% peak efficiency in a compact 18mm x 23mm2 footprint. The new ZL9024M operates from a 3.3V rail and outputs 33A of power in a 17mm x19mm2 footprint. They deliver point-of-load (POL) conversions for advanced FPGAs, DSPs, ASICs and memory used in servers, telecom, datacom, optical networking and storage equipment. Both devices are easy-to-use, PMBus-configurable power supplies that include a controller, MOSFETs, inductor and passives encapsulated inside a module that increases available board space and reduces bill of materials (BOM). | Leer la noticia completa | 31 de Jan de 2018 - 06:52 PM | |
Renesas Electronics Expands RX130 MCU Lineup to Enhance Functionality for Touch-Based Home Appliances and Industrial Automation Applications |  Düsseldorf, January 29, 2018 – Renesas Electronics today announced 38 new microcontrollers (MCUs) in its RX130 Group. The new MCUs extend flash memory size to 256 KB, 384 KB and 512 KB, and increase package size up to 100-pins to provide higher performance and compatibility with the RX231/RX230 Group of touch MCUs. The ultra-low power, low-cost RX130 Group adds higher responsiveness and functionality for touch-based home appliances, and building and industrial automation applications requiring 3V or 5V system control and low power consumption. Featuring a new capacitive touch IP with improved sensitivity and robustness, and a comprehensive device evaluation environment, the new 32-bit RX130 MCUs are an ideal fit for devices designed with challenging, non-traditional touch materials, or required to operate in wet or dirty environments, such as a kitchen, bath, or factory floor. | Leer la noticia completa | 29 de Jan de 2018 - 06:51 PM | |

Renesas Electronics Europe Announces New High-Speed Optocouplers Offering Extended Operating Temperature Range Combined with High Isolation and Shielding Features | Dusseldorf – Renesas Electronics Europe today announced the availability of two new high-performance optocouplers, the PS9324 and the PS9123, for industrial and motor control applications. The new high-speed optocouplers are designed for 10 megabits per second (Mbps) high-speed operation over an extended temperature range: between -40°C and 100°C for the PS9123 series and up to 110°C for the PS9324 series. The new devices comply with international safety standards such as UL, CSA and VDE (optional), making them ideally suited for applications in harsh industrial environments such as factory automation (FA), measurement equipment and motor-control. | Leer la noticia completa | 21 de Feb de 2012 - 10:28 PM | |
Renesas Electronics Introduces 576-Megabit Low-Latency DRAM for Network Equipment Combining Large Capacity, High Speed, and Low Power Consumption | Renesas Electronics, a premier provider of advanced semiconductor solutions, today announced the availability of a family of 576-megabit (Mb) low-latency DRAM products (μPD48576109, μPD48576118, μPD48576209, μPD48576218, and μPD48576236) for network equipment. The 576Mb low-latency DRAM products offer doubled memory capacity, 25 percent improved random cycle performance for high-speed reading and writing of data, 33 percent faster operating frequency, and over 10 percent reduction in power consumption compared to the company’s existing 288 Mb low-latency DRAM products | Leer la noticia completa | 19 de Jan de 2011 - 06:11 PM | |
